Not everything was vineyards, not everything is vineyards: History and heritage in Mendoza's green belt

It combines historical review, architectural analysis, and field surveys with interviews, generating an inventory of 248 properties. The book articulates history, architecture, agricultural production, and territorial planning from an interdisciplinary approach, showing how heritage can be a tool for sustainable development, responsible tourism, and territorial management. It proposes the green belt as a “living landscape” and constitutes a valuable resource for researchers, planners, cultural managers, and local actors, also encouraging further research to expand the heritage inventory.
